Get Your Hands Dirty & Save: The Ultimate Guide to DIY Auto Repair
Are you tired of shelling out big bucks at the auto center? Want to take control of your car's maintenance and learn some valuable skills? Well, look no further! DIY auto repair is easier than you think. With a little bit of patience, the right tools, and our helpful tips, you can tackle even complex car problems yourself. Not only will you reduce money on expensive repairs, but you'll also gain a newfound sense of satisfaction knowing you fixed your car with your own two hands.
- Begin small: Begin with basic maintenance tasks like oil changes, air filter replacements, and tire rotations. These are relatively simple repairs that can be done at home with minimal tools.
- Collect the right tools: Invest in a quality set of wrenches, sockets, screwdrivers, and other essential tools. A reliable repair manual specific to your vehicle model is also crucial.
- Learn from experts: There are countless online resources, videos, and tutorials available that can guide you through various auto repairs step-by-step.
- Prioritize safety always: Always wear protective gear, like gloves and eye protection, and work in a well-ventilated area. Disconnect the battery before working on any electrical components.
Never be afraid to ask for help: If you encounter a problem you can't solve, don't hesitate to reach out to a more experienced mechanic or friend for assistance.
